Automatic Data Processing Inc
A maker of payroll and human-resources software, ADP runs platforms like RUN Powered by ADP for small businesses, ADP Workforce Now for mid-size and large firms, and ADP Lyric HCM for global enterprises, plus co-employment services through ADP TotalSource. It was founded in 1949 in Paterson, New Jersey, as Automatic Payrolls, Inc., and renamed itself Automatic Data Processing in 1958 after switching from manual bookkeeping to punched-card machines and mainframe computers. Fun fact: despite the "automatic" in its original name, the early work was done by hand with calculators and mechanical bookkeeping machines.
